🌤️ 1. Use Natural Light
Natural daylight is your best tool.
- Place artwork near a window
- Avoid direct sunlight
- Shoot during soft daylight hours
👉 Tip: Overcast days give perfect, even lighting.

📱 3. Use Your Smartphone
Modern phones are more than enough.
- Use rear camera
- Keep steady (tripod helps)
- Avoid zoom
👉 Great images don’t require expensive equipment—just good technique.

🔍 5. Show Detail
Always include:
- Full artwork
- Close-ups
- Texture
👉 This increases perceived value and buyer confidence.
📐 6. Get Angles Right
- Keep camera parallel
- Avoid distortion
- Use gridlines
👉 Straight, aligned images = professional results.

⚠️ Common Mistakes
Avoid:
- Dark images
- Glare
- Crooked shots
- Cluttered backgrounds
